    Are you taking nutrition advice from the 140lbs running guy? :D

    While there may be limits on what the maximum amount of protein you might be able to use, more is not going to hurt you and displacing lower value calories is likely beneficial as well. I personally was in the 1g/lbs range when I was bulking, now I’m closer to .85g/lbs.

    There are also things that help in protein utilization, including the sauce. But carbs can be protein sparing as well.

    Eating a huge amount of protein isn’t a magic bullet but if you are really kicking the shit out of your muscles, I feel that more certainly aids in recovery and growth. What I wouldn’t do is waste a tonne of cash on supplements...protein powder if you can stomach it, and the rest of your cash on real food.

    He's bang on, and his advice that it's about working the muscle rather than moving the heaviest weight possible translates to all areas of bodybuilding. Strength sports is about making heavy weight feel light and bodybuilding is about making light weight feel heavy.
